Study Abroad Success: Tailored Tips for Pakistani Students

Unlocking your dreams with studying abroad can be a truly rewarding experience. A number of Pakistani students have successfully navigated the path to academic excellence in international institutions. However, achieving achievement abroad requires careful planning and preparation.

Here are some tips tailored specifically for Pakistani students embarking on this exciting journey:

* **Research Extensively:** Explore various countries, universities, and programs that align with your personal goals.

* **Financial Planning:** Understand the costs involved, including tuition fees, living expenses, and visa applications. Consider scholarships, grants, and part-time job opportunities.

* **Language Proficiency:** Many universities require English language proficiency tests like IELTS or TOEFL. Prepare adequately in advance to achieve a satisfactory score.

* **Cultural Adaptation:** Be open to new cultures, customs, and perspectives. Embrace the opportunity to discover about different ways of life.

* **Networking:** Connect with other Pakistani students studying abroad or alumni from your university. They can provide invaluable advice and support.

* **Seek Guidance:** Consult with your university's international office or study abroad advisors for personalized help.
